Autoforwarding Public Appointments to a Group

Autoforwarding Public Appointments to a Group

Question:
How do I forward appointments made to a public calendar to a set group of people?

Answer:
That’s fairly easy to do. First, open your folder list (View | Folder List) and locate the public calendar folder in question. Then right click on it and select “Properties.” Go to the “Administration” tab and select “Folder Assistant.” Now click “Add Rule.”

If you want to send all of the items posted to the calendar to the group, you can leave all of the criteria (From, Subject, etc.) blank. Otherwise, you can specify certain words to watch for or subject lines to match.

Towards the bottom of the rule editor dialog box you’ll see some choices for what action to take. Select “Forward” and enter the name(s) of the people you want to send it to or, better yet, the distribution list that they all belong to (create one if you don’t already have one).

You also have choices about what format to send it in:

  • “Standard” will send an appointment item just to the recipients from the calendar folder.
  • “Leave item intact” will send the appointment item as well, but the “From” field will be the person who created the appointment item in the public folder.
  • “Insert item as attachment” will send an e-mail message to the group from the public folder, with the calendar item inserted in the message as an attachment.
